
“Days of Plums – 48th International Fair of Agriculture and Food Industry” were opened in Gradacac today on the plateau of the Sports Hall “Skenderija”, which the organizers said was a traditional Bosnian brand.
Federal Minister of Agriculture, Water Management and Forestry Semsudin Dedic congratulated the organizers on the opening of the fair, expressing his belief that businessmen will achieve cooperation and sign new contracts through business meetings. The Minister also expressed the expectation that this traditional fair will contribute to the development of the agricultural and food industry in Bosnia and Herzegovina, especially bearing in mind that during the pandemic, restrictive measures were introduced, which reduced the possibility of business meetings.
He stressed that the Federation of BiH has ensured the regular payment of incentives for production, while last year and this year a public call was issued to support rural development. This will enable farmers to provide grant funds for the purchase of new equipment.
“Every year we face some climate disasters such as drought, frost and floods, which is why capital support to rural development enables the implementation of projects for irrigation of agricultural land and water drainage or procurement of anti-hail protection,” Dedic explained.
The goal is to train as many agricultural plots as possible with local communities and agricultural producers that have irrigation systems, because, says Dedic, there will be less talk about disasters, and more about yields.
As the Prime Minister of Tuzla Canton Kadrija Hodzic reminded, the fair has a tradition of almost 50 years and brings with it a tradition of economic development and provides opportunities for stimulating development, connecting people and developing trust.
